Tax Year Prior to 2020: What if my parents claimed me as a dependent in 2019 but I no longer live with them in 2020 can I still claim the stimulus check?

Your dad does not need your permission to claim you if he qualifies to do so.   A parent can claim their child if:

 

Qualifying child

  • They're related to you.
  • They aren't claimed as a dependent by someone else.
  • They're a U.S. citizen, resident alien, national, or a Canadian or Mexican resident.
  • They aren’t filing a joint return with their spouse.
  • They're under the age of 19 (or 24 for full-time students).
    • No age limit for permanently and totally disabled children.
  • They lived with you for more than half the year (exceptions apply).
  • They didn't provide more than half of their own support for the year.

If you provided more than half of your own support, you can't be claimed as a dependent.   However, if your father already claimed you and you try to e-file as an independent taxpayer, your return will be rejected.   But, if you are eligible to file as independent, claim the recovery rebate, and mail your return.   Your father will have to amend his return and pay back any credits received for you if the IRS determines that he can not claim you.   If you are claimed on 2 tax returns, the IRS will intervene.   @gumbie13

Tax Year Prior to 2020: What if my parents claimed me as a dependent in 2019 but I no longer live with them in 2020 can I still claim the stimulus check?

I am a 20 year old college student. My parents claimed me as a dependent in 2019 but are not claiming me for 2020 taxes. Can I get the stimulus check? And if so how?

Tax Year Prior to 2020: What if my parents claimed me as a dependent in 2019 but I no longer live with them in 2020 can I still claim the stimulus check?

Just by filling out your 2020 return.  

The Stimulus Checks are really based on your 2020 return we are filing in 2021.  So any amount you already got will be reconciled on your 2020 return line 30.  If you didn't get a Stimulus Check (and qualify) or you qualify for more it will be added to your 2020 return.  But the good news is if they paid you too much they won't take it back.

 

There will be a screen with 2 boxes for each round.  If you didn't get one enter a 0 in the box.

Tax Year Prior to 2020: What if my parents claimed me as a dependent in 2019 but I no longer live with them in 2020 can I still claim the stimulus check?

If you are not their dependent, file a 2020 Tax return. 

If you were their dependent for 2020, you are not eligible whether they claim you or not. 

 

According to the IRS:

 

"Economic Impact Payments were based on your 2018 or 2019 tax year information. The Recovery Rebate Credit is similar except that the eligibility and the amount are based on 2020 information you include on your 2020 tax return."
